It must be admitted that, to a certain extent, expectoration is a
voluntary operation, connected with the action of a variety of muscles,
which in a state of extreme debility are not easily excited into action:
every practitioner must have noticed this fact during the treatment of
the coughs of exhausted patients, and have witnessed the distress
necessarily arising from it; in this condition, the exhibition of a
stimulant may so far renew the exhausted excitability of these organs,
as to enable them to undergo the necessary exertions.
_b._ _By compressing the thoracic viscera, through the operation of an
emetic._
The beneficial results which frequently attend the concussion of an
emetic, in cases of mucous accumulations in the lungs, are too well
known and understood to require much elucidation: in the act of vomiting
the thoracic viscera are violently compressed, the neighbouring muscles
are also called into strong action, and both expiration and inspiration
are thus rendered more forcible, and the expulsion of mucus from the
cavity of the lungs necessarily accomplished.
The safety and expediency of such a resource must, however, in each
particular case be left to the discretion of the medical practitioner.
Besides the remedies above enumerated, there are some others which
afford relief in certain coughs, and have therefore in popular medicine,
been considered as _Expectorants_; but their operation, if they exert
any, is to be explained upon principles altogether different from that
of facilitating expectoration, and will more properly fall under the
head of _Demulcents_.
Atmospheric changes, in relation to moisture and dryness, deserve some
notice before we conclude the history of expectorant agents: the subject
teems with curious and important facts, and the advantages which the
asthmatic patient derives from such changes merit farther investigation.
That the lungs are constantly giving off aqueous vapour is made evident
by condensing the expired air on a cold surface of glass or metal; and
it is easy to imagine that when the atmosphere is saturated with
moisture, its power of conducting off this vapour will be proportionably
diminished, and that an accumulation of fluid may thus take place in the
lungs; on the other hand, we may suppose the air to be so dry as to have
an increased capacity for moisture, and to carry off the expired vapour
with preternatural avidity; in either of these cases, the excretions
from the lungs will be materially influenced, whether to the benefit or
disadvantage of the patient will depend, in each particular instance,
upon the nature of the disease under which he suffers. I have known a
person who could breathe with more freedom in the thick fogs of the
metropolis than in the pure air of a mountainous region, and it would
not be difficult to adduce many examples in illustration of a
diametrically opposite constitution of the pulmonary organs.
